Summary on the creation of Reddit
Reddit, founded in 2005 by Steve Huffman and Alexis Ohanian, quickly became one of the most popular sites on the Internet. Originally, Reddit was a place to share interesting links and discussions, but over the years, it has become much more than that. Today, Reddit is a true cultural phenomenon, hosting millions of discussions on everything from the latest news to DIY tips.

How does Reddit work?
Reddit operates on a voting system. Users can upvote or downvote posts and comments they like or dislike. This allows the community to determine which content is most relevant or interesting.

What is a subreddit on Reddit?
A subreddit is essentially an online community dedicated to a specific topic. Whether you're passionate about cats, urban landscape photography, or memes, there's probably a subreddit for you on Reddit. Each subreddit has its own rules, moderators, and members, creating an endless variety of virtual communities.

How to leverage Reddit in your marketing strategy
Reddit can be a powerful tool for marketers, but it must be used carefully. Reddit users are known to be wary of promotional content, so it's important to engage authentically and respect the rules of each subreddit.
